Self-Hosting Websites vs. WYSIWYG Builders: Advantages and Disadvantages in Building Platforms

Self-Hosting Websites vs. WYSIWYG Builders: Advantages and Disadvantages in Building Platforms

When considering the building of a platform, businesses and individuals often face a choice between self-hosting websites and using WYSIWYG What You See Is What You Get website builders. This article delves into the advantages and disadvantages of each option, helping you make an informed decision for your needs.

Self-Hosting Websites

Advantages

Full Control: With self-hosting, you maintain complete control over your website's server, files, and configurations. This provides extensive customization options. Flexibility: You can choose any technology stack, frameworks, and content management systems (CMS) that align with your project requirements, such as WordPress, Joomla, or custom solutions. Scalability: As your website grows, it's easier to scale up by upgrading server resources or optimizing performance. Ownership: Owning your data and content reduces dependence on third-party services, ensuring data privacy and security. Security: Proper knowledge and implementation of robust security measures can tailor protection to your specific needs.

Disadvantages

Technical Expertise Required: Self-hosting requires a good understanding of web development, server maintenance, and security practices. Time-Consuming: Setting up and maintaining a self-hosted site can be more time-intensive compared to using a WYSIWYG builder. Costs: Higher costs for hosting services, domain registration, and possibly hiring developers for maintenance. Maintenance: Ongoing responsibility for updates, backups, and security patches.

WYSIWYG Website Builders

Advantages

ease of Use: Designed for users with little to no coding experience, making it simple to create and manage websites. Quick Setup: Rapid deployment with pre-designed templates and user-friendly drag-and-drop interfaces. Integrated Features: Built-in features like SEO tools, e-commerce capabilities, and analytics. Support: Often include customer support, tutorials, and community forums to assist users.

Disadvantages

Limited Customization: May restrict design and functionality options, making it harder to implement unique features or designs. Dependency: Relying on third-party services can lead to issues if the provider changes policies, pricing, or ceases operations. Performance: Some WYSIWYG builders may have slower performance or less optimized compared to self-hosted solutions. Recurring Costs: Subscription fees can add up over time, potentially making maintenance more expensive in the long run.

Conclusion

The choice between self-hosting and using a WYSIWYG builder depends on your specific needs, technical expertise, and long-term goals. If you prioritize complete control, customization, and have the technical skills to manage your site, self-hosting might be the better choice. Conversely, if ease of use, quick deployment, and pre-designed features are your top priorities, a WYSIWYG builder could be more suitable.